General labor is where a jobsite gets exposed fastest: send someone who isn't OSHA 10 certified or who climbs onto a lift they were never trained to run, and you've got a worker turned away at the gate, a buildout crew idle while material sits, or a safety incident on a demo floor. Precision verifies OSHA 10, forklift and lift certifications, and fall-protection awareness against what your site actually requires before anyone shows up, carries workers' comp and liability on every laborer, and backs the placement with an 8-hour satisfaction guarantee, so a bad fit costs you the morning, not the project.

Credentials we verify
Credentials are part of insuring the work, not paperwork. Depending on your scope, the checks we run for construction general labor typically include:
- OSHA 10
- Forklift and lift certifications where the site requires them
- Fall-protection awareness training
- Site-specific safety orientation readiness
